Dr. Hu

Dr. Hu, 2021

Picture
In this video performance, Gladys plays the role of Dr. Hu, whose purpose in life is to fix everything that’s broken. She stops by whenever she comes across anything that seems wounded or damaged, including both living and non-living entities. As a ‘professional’, Dr. Hu utilizes the apparatus in her first aid kit to repair them with her original, experimental treatment methods.

​Dr. Hu reflects on the egocentric nature of humans, pointing at how we tend to focus on our own problems and overlook the feelings and wellbeing of others. The video challenges the viewers pay attention to the vulnerability of the things around us, encouraging them to heal and care for others with a gentle heart.
